Understanding False Signals
False signals can occur due to electromagnetic interference, highly mineralized ground, or proximity to buried metal infrastructure. Adjusting sensitivity and discrimination settings can often resolve these.
Learning to interpret different signal patterns is a key skill developed with the Berkut 5 metal detector. It teaches users to differentiate between genuine targets and environmental noise.

Ethical Considerations and Best Practices
Responsible detecting involves respecting property rights, obtaining permission before searching, and minimizing environmental impact. It also means understanding and adhering to local laws regarding artifact recovery.
Educators should stress the importance of leaving sites as they found them, filling in all holes, and avoiding damage to landscapes or historical sites. This ethical framework is paramount.
Proper Digging and Recovery Techniques
Learning to dig carefully and recover targets without causing damage is a vital skill. This includes using appropriate digging tools and backfilling holes neatly.
The goal is to retrieve the target and restore the ground surface to its original condition. This practice ensures that metal detecting remains a sustainable and respected hobby.
Reporting Significant Finds
In many regions, significant historical finds must be reported to relevant authorities. This ensures that important artifacts are preserved and studied properly.
Educating users on how and when to report finds contributes to archaeological research and the preservation of cultural heritage. The Berkut 5 metal detector can lead to such discoveries.
